Sales of existing single-family homes in Greensboro, NC were down by 32.4 percent in March.
According to data released by the Greensboro Regional Realtors Association, 357 homes were sold in the city in March 2009 compared to 528 in March 2008. 310 houses sold in February.
The median price for homes fell 14 percent, to $121,000. That was a slight increase from the median home price of $118,500 in February.
The total dollar volume for all sales, at $52.8 million, was still off by more than 40 percent compared to a year ago. February total dollar volume was $44.6 million.
